         <title>World Heritage Committee Inscribes 48 New Sites on Heritage List</title>
         <description><![CDATA[Marrakesh - UNESCO&apos;s World Heritage Committee, meeting since November 29 in Marrakesh (Morocco), has inscribed 48 new cultural and natural sites on the World Heritage List. The List now has 630 sites of &amp;quot;exceptional universal value&amp;quot; in 118 countries. Sites in South Africa, Nigeria, Saint Kitts and Nevis, and Turkmenistan are on the List for the first time.          <title>World Heritage Committee Inscribes 46 New Sites on World Heritage List</title>
         <description><![CDATA[The following sites have been inscribed on the World Heritage List by the World Heritage Committee at its 21st session, meeting in Naples, Italy, 1-6 December, 1997. A total of 46 sites were inscribed: 7 natural sites; 38 cultural sites; and 1 mixed site.
